By utilizing the Nokē API, businesses can gain accountability and visibility by integrating their existing platforms with Nokē to avoid complicated management processes, multiple platforms, and redundancy.
INTEGRATION SIMPLIFIED
Nokē's integration solution positions Nokē as the only industrial lock manufacturer that can seamlessly plug into customers existing platforms, apps, data, and analytics, and create a network effect of systems working together.
HERE ARE THE KEY BENEFITS:
EASY TO USE
Manages only locks and keys, simply adding that data to your user management system
QUICK TO IMPLEMENT
API wrappers in most common programming languages and native mobile libraries for iOS and Android
SECURE
Two layers of 128-bit AES encryption
CUSTOMIZABLE
Provides freedom to customize all Nokē features according to individual needs
FAST
Always in active development allowing for feature requests to be quickly implemented
DOCUMENTATION
Comprehensive documentation and examples for all endpoints and sandbox environment for testing
A PLATFORM OF YOUR OWN
Nokē API not only provides seemless integration but also offers the flexibility to manage your own system
API COMMUNICATION FEATURES:
INTERNAL MANAGEMENT
Nokē only manages the encrypted keys for locks. All other user data is managed internally by client.
NOKĒ DATA ACCESS LIMITED
Mobile app, server, and all user data, event history, and company information is not accessible to Nokē.
NOKĒ SERVER ACCESS LIMITED
Communication with Nokē servers is limited to one-way requests for encrypted keys via a RESTful API and requires an API key.
BLUETOOTH
All Bluetooth communication with locks is handled through the integrated Nokē mobile library for Android and iOS.
YOU CAN BUILD A BASIC OR COMPLEX SYSTEM AND WHEN IT'S TIME TO OPEN YOUR LOCK, WE'LL PROVIDE THE KEY
HERE'S HOW THE NOKĒ CORE API WORKS:
LOCK
MOBILE APP & CORE LIBRARY
NOKĒ SERVER
NOKĒ CLOUD
NOKĒ CORE API
NOKĒ CLOUD
NOKĒ SERVER
MOBILE APP & CORE LIBRARY
LOCK
Nokē lock connects to Nokē Mobile app via Bluetooth and user requests unlock
Mobile app sends lock and user data to the Nokē cloud
The cloud authenticates user and lock. If user has permission to unlock the lock, cloud sends request to the Nokē Core API
Nokē Core API generates and encrypts the unlock command using the lock's keys (stored on secure Nokē servers)
Cloud receives unlock command from API and passes it to the mobile app
Mobile app sends command to the lock and the lock opens
SAFE, SECURE, AND UNHACKABLE
Nokē API security protocols
NOKĒ API SECURITY
Utilizing an independent, end to end 128-bit AES encryption with an additional layer of 128-bit AES, the Nokē team of technology experts works hard to ensure that our system of rigorous and audited API security mechanisms and protocols are built to restrict all unauthorized access.